Okay, craft a modern SaaS landing page website using DaisyUI and Tailwind CSS, focusing on a clean, professional aesthetic. The site should highlight a fictional SaaS product that streamlines project management for remote teams. Design a hero section with a compelling headline, a concise sub-headline explaining the product's core value proposition, and a prominent call-to-action button that encourages users to "Start Free Trial." Incorporate a visually appealing hero image or animation that demonstrates the product's interface or benefits. Below the hero section, create a "Features" section with three to four key features, each presented with an icon, a descriptive title, and a short paragraph explaining the feature's benefits. Utilize DaisyUI's card components for a structured layout. Include a "How It Works" section with a step-by-step visual guide, using DaisyUI's steps component, outlining the product's workflow. Add a "Testimonials" section featuring three customer testimonials with profile pictures and quotes, using DaisyUI's carousel or card components for a clean presentation. Implement a "Pricing" section with three pricing tiers, each clearly outlining the features and pricing, using DaisyUI's pricing table or card components. Design a "Frequently Asked Questions" (FAQ) section using DaisyUI's accordion component to answer common user queries. Finally, create a footer with links to key pages like "Terms of Service," "Privacy Policy," and "Contact Us," along with social media icons. Ensure the website is fully responsive for all screen sizes. Utilize the "Inter" font throughout the website for a modern and readable typography. Emphasize a consistent color palette with a primary accent color that aligns with the SaaS product's branding. Use smooth animations and transitions provided by Tailwind CSS and DaisyUI for an engaging user experience. Optimize all images and assets for fast loading times. Provide a clear and concise navigation menu at the top of the page, including links to "Features," "Pricing," and "Contact." Ensure the website's design is clean, professional, and reflects the modern SaaS industry standards.
